Yesterday, the regular coordination meeting was held between the Syrian Democratic Council, the Democratic Autonomous Administration of North and East Syria, and the Syrian Democratic Forces, according to what was published by the media center of the same parties.

The discussion focused on assessing the current situation in the country, and the progress of the ongoing dialogue with the Damascus authorities.

During the meeting, the field and political situations in the country were discussed, with a focus on the necessity of working to enhance security and political stability, especially in light of the increasing challenges facing the region. The importance of continuing the dialogue with the Damascus authorities was emphasized, and striving to achieve tangible results that contribute to finding solutions to the pending issues, in a way that guarantees the rights and interests of all Syrian components.

The attendees agreed to intensify efforts to hold a series of local meetings in various cities and towns in North and East Syria, with the aim of involving all societal groups in the political process, and ensuring that the outcomes of the dialogue represent the will of all components of the region.

The importance of the ongoing dialogue with the Damascus authorities was also emphasized.

In this context, the meeting stressed its keenness to make this dialogue a success by finding a solution to the details and issues being discussed, through an agreement to reach an appropriate implementation mechanism, such as merging military and administrative institutions, and the return of forcibly displaced persons to their areas of origin. Stressing the need to identify appropriate tools to achieve understandings on these issues.

The meeting also discussed the issue of a ceasefire, and considered it a necessary step to ensure the progress of the dialogue, stressing that achieving field stability contributes to creating an appropriate environment for continuing political discussions and reaching constructive understandings.

The attendees called on the Damascus authorities to assume their responsibilities towards the ceasefire and take practical steps to prove their seriousness in moving towards a comprehensive and just political solution.
